Akanji: meaning, origin, and characteristics uncovered

Meaning: The One Whose Touch Gives Life | Origin: African - Yoruba | Neutral

Akanji is a gender-neutral name of African origin, specifically from the Yoruba culture. In Yoruba tradition, names carry significant meanings that reflect the characteristics and aspirations of the individual or family. The name Akanji is derived from the Yoruba language and holds a profound significance.

The name Akanji is interpreted as “The One Whose Touch Gives Life.” This beautiful and powerful meaning suggests a person who has the ability to bring vitality, healing, and positive energy to those around them. Geographical distribution and cultural features

The name Akanji originates from the Yoruba culture in West Africa, specifically Nigeria. It is a name that holds significance in the cultural and linguistic heritage of the Yoruba people. The Yoruba ethnic group is one of the largest in Nigeria, with a rich history and diverse cultural practices.

The name Akanji is often given to both males and females in the Yoruba community, symbolizing the idea of someone whose touch brings life and vitality. It is a name that reflects the values and beliefs of the Yoruba people, emphasizing the importance of life-giving qualities.

Furthermore, the geographical distribution of individuals with the name Akanji extends beyond Nigeria to other parts of the world where the Yoruba diaspora has spread.
